Yesterday after work I was haveing a bit of a trouble getting the 04 America to start. She'd turn over easily just not fire. (Both in gear with the clutch pulled and in N on the stand.) I pulled the plug wires one at a time to check for spark, but didn't see anything, (really bright outside) after that check all the fuses, all good. Figured I try agin and she fired right up, one 1 cylender I might add, stupid me forgot to put the left side plug back on. Anyway, after that she ran great, went to visit a friend up in TN. Fired right back up when I left. No issuse since. I'm just wondering "What the Hell" is there something I need to be on the lookout for? Maybe pick up coil begining to fail?

I finally got my bike fixed thru Preferred Power Sports in Brewerton/Cicero NY. Chris diagnosed a bad p/u or trip coil which runs to the lower right case. Figured might as well have it done there rather than replacing parts. He said it should be putting out 600 ohms or whatever and it was only getting 24. Quite the difference. That explains why i could feel the bike kind of dragging. I thought i might have motor issues the way it felt. 1 hour ride no probs. I'm happy again. Out a few hunnerd bucks, but highly satisfied.
